Production Details
The pipe chain conveyor, commonly referred to as a pipe chain machine, pipe conveyor, or chain conveyor, is an exemplary solution for the continuous transportation of powders, small particles, and loose materials. Its versatile design allows for horizontal, inclined, and vertical material conveyance. Utilizing a closed pipeline system, the chain functions as a robust transmission component, propelling material seamlessly through the pipeline.
In horizontal conveyance, material particles are efficiently pushed by the chain in the direction of motion. The internal friction force between material layers surpasses the external friction against the pipe wall, enabling the material to move synchronously with the chain, creating a consistent material flow.
During vertical conveyance, material particles within the pipe are driven upwards by the chain. The lower feeding mechanism prevents the upper material from sliding, generating lateral pressure that amplifies the internal friction force of the material, ensuring smooth upward movement.
When the internal friction force among materials exceeds both the external friction against the pipe's inner wall and the material's own weight, a continuous material flow is achieved as the material is conveyed upwards with the chain.

Product Features
Advantages of Pipe Chain Conveyors
Effortless Maintenance: With a primary drive system based on chains, the structure is simplified, facilitating easy maintenance. Regular checks and lubrication of chains are sufficient to ensure prolonged and stable operation of the equipment.
Dust-Free Operation: The pipe chain conveyor's fully enclosed design effectively
handles dust, odors, toxic, and even harmful substances, ensuring a clean and safe environment.

Pipeline Chain Conveying System Applications:
1. Plastic Industry: Efficiently handles PVC, PP, PE powders, ABS, PC, PP, PE particles.
2. Fine Chemicals: Ideal for transporting dyes, pigments, coatings, carbon black, titanium pigments, iron oxide, ceramic powder, heavy calcium carbonate, fine particle calcium carbonate, bentonite, molecular sieve, porcelain clay, silicon powder, activated carbon.
3. Mining Industry: Suitable for urea, ammonium chloride, ammonium bicarbonate, soda powder, solid pesticides, tungsten powder, fish oil, copper powder, coal powder, block phosphate, bauxite, and more.
4. Building Materials: Capable of conveying cement, clay, yellow sand, quartz sand, clay powder, silicon, lime powder, dolomite powder, sawdust, glass fiber, silica, painting powder.
5. Food Industry: Efficiently transports flour, starch, grains, milk powder, food additives, and more.
